- The distance between Meiktila, Myanmar and Cape Town, South Africa is approximately 10,182 km or 6,327 mi.
- To reach Meiktila in this distance one would set out from Cape Town bearing 65.8°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Meiktila bearing 54° or NE .
- Meiktila is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Cape Town is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 10.4 °C (18.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.6 °C (1.1°F) more in Meiktila.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 331 mm (13 in) more which is equivalent to 331 l/m² (8.12 US gal/ft²) or 3,310,000 l/ha (353,861 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.2° higher in Meiktila than in Cape Town.
